Your experience vs. customer reality
As an owner, you usually test on a modern phone and fast office internet. Lighthouse simulates average customer conditions: weaker mobile signal, transit use, and older devices.
In this case, Largest Contentful Paint (LCP) was 8.7 seconds. While the owner perceived smooth performance, a significant share of mobile visitors was waiting far too long for meaningful content.

Why standard platforms often plateau
Platforms such as Lightspeed and Shopify are excellent to start with. But as stores grow, scripts, trackers and app layers accumulate. Visible license costs stay low while hidden performance costs rise.
Think of it as a car carrying more and more luggage: it still runs, but acceleration gets worse and efficiency drops.
